Belden Inc. is hiring a Professional Services Engineer (PSE) to support a major U.S. customer in the Greater Boston area and throughout the US. This role is ideal for a hands-on engineer who enjoys owning projects end-to-end‑network assessment, design, configuration, field deployment, commissioning, documentation, and customer handoff-in industrial/operational environments where uptime and safety matter.
You’ll work at the intersection ofindustrial wired/wireless networking, OT security, and field execution, partnering with customer stakeholders, controls/SCADA teams, ISPs/carriers, and internal Belden teams to bring critical sites online reliably and securely.
Location: Greater Boston, MA (onsite/hybrid at one of Belden Inc.'s largest wired/wireless customers in the U.S.)

Applicants can expect a base compensation range of $110,000 - $160,000.00, plus benefits and additional incentives based on the level of the role. This is the reasonable estimate that Belden believes it might pay for this job based on applicable circumstances at the time of posting. Belden may ultimately pay more or less than the posted range as permitted by law, and commensurate with the applicant's experience, qualifications, and geographical location.
Belden also offers hybrid and remote work practices where feasible and provides employees with benefits that could include health/dental/vision, long term/short term disability, life insurance, HSA/FSA, matching retirement plans, paid vacation, parental leave, employee stock purchase plan, paid leave for volunteer work in your community, training opportunities, professional talent management and succession planning, corporate health well-being initiatives and a work culture which includes commitment to diversity, equity, inclusion and sustainability!
